Camphouse Rice

Prep: 10 min Cook: 30 min Serves: 4 Cuisine: American

Camphouse Rice is a hearty, flavorful one-pot dish featuring rice, sausage or shrimp, vegetables, and spices, perfect for a comforting family meal or casual gathering.

Ingredients

  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 1 medium b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 clove garlic, crushed
  • 1 Tbsp. olive oil
  • 1 lb. Polish sausage or shrimp
  • 1 1/2 c. rice
  • 4 c. water
  • 1 can chopped tomatoes
  • 1 small can mushrooms
  • salt
  • pepper
  • 1 medium jalapeno pepper, chopped (optional)

Instructions

  1. Chop the onion, bell pepper, garlic, and jalapeno pepper (if using).
  2. Sauté the chopped onion, bell pepper, garlic, and jalapeno in olive oil until softened.
  3. Add the sausage or shrimp to the pan and cook until browned or cooked through.
  4. Stir in chopped tomatoes, mushrooms, rice, salt, and pepper.
  5. Pour in water, b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er until rice is tender and liquid is absorbed.
